REIL floats bids for 50 MW rooftop solar projects

Rajasthan Electronics & Instruments Limited (REIL) has issued a request for proposals to develop 50 MWp of grid-connected rooftop solar capacity on government buildings across India’s states and union territories. The scope of work for the winning developer will include rooftop solar PV power system, along with the related power evacuation and transmission systems alongwith site assessment, design, manufacture, supply, erection, testing, and commissioning.

The bidder will also provide operation and maintenance assistance for the next 25 years. The plants will be established using the RESCO model. The ceiling tariff for general category states and union territories is Rs 5.15 per kWh. However, for special category states and union territories, it is Rs 6.25 per kWh.

In September 2022, REIL issued a tender to appoint agencies to identify, install, operate, and maintain 738 electric vehicle (EV) charging stations across India. The appointed agency will invest in upstream electrical infrastructure for charging stations such as transformers, cabling, load enhancement, a new electrical connection from the distribution company, and recurring expenses such as data charges, maintenance, and workforce for operation.
